What Is Boruto’s Eye? Full Plot Explanation

The anime and the manga have different interpretations of Boruto’s eye. The manga has still left the majority of its information to be explained, but the anime has helped supplement most information.

Boruto’s eye is named the Jougan. It’s exclusive to Boruto and allows him to see chakra paths and travel beyond dimensions. The eye is only known by the Otsutsuki Clan who warn of its immense power and inevitable clash with a preordained destiny.

Role In The Plot

In the anime, Boruto first thinks his Jougan could be the Byakugan awakening from his Mother’s side. It proved unexplainable for the time being. Boruto only used the Jougan accidentally during times of combat and stress. 

Eventually, Boruto and Momoshiki meet. It’s learned the eye has a connection with the Otsutsuki clan, implying Boruto was always meant to meet one of its members to unlock the eye’s full potential.

Momoshiki left a mark on Boruto after their battle. The mark has opened up over time, revealed to hold Momoshiki’s spirit as it attempts to take over Boruto’s body. Momoshiki’s life was on a timer and Boruto proved an appropriate vessel. Boruto could initially keep control of his mark but now suffers from resisting Momoshiki’s influence.

In chapter 53, Boruto’s Jougan activates as Momoshiki takes full control for the first time. The Jougan seemingly flares up over Momoshiki’s presence. The eye signifies Boruto’s connection with the Otsutsuki clan and his inevitable demise as a vessel.

The flash-forward of Boruto facing off against Kawaki shows a level of control over the Jougan. Boruto is in a similar state to when Momoshiki first took over, but the power seems to flow with his own free will.

Only a few characters know about Boruto’s Jougan. Naruto knows about Boruto’s eye as well as Sasuke. In the anime, Boruto told his father about the eye under the impression it may be an awakened Byakugan.

The Jougan’s abilities are a mix of all 3 Dōjutsu eyes. It can transport Boruto through dimensions like the Rinnegan, allow him to sense chakra like the Sharingan and see through obstructions like the Byakugan. The Jougan is likely the strongest than those three eyes.

It’s unfair to say the Jougan is the absolute best since we don’t know the full implications of its role in the main plot. However, it does seem to have abilities that either exceed or match the abilities of other legendary eyes.

The Jougan has been Boruto’s eye forever. Only over the course of the series has it shown to contain abilities reminiscent of the other Dojutsu eyes. It’s implied to connect Boruto to an otherworldly clan.
